6.5. Downloading More Transition Choices

Simple cuts, cross dissolves , and fade-ins/fade-outs are all the transitions many professionals ever need. But if you're feeling hemmed in by the limited number of built-in transitions, you can download plenty more to expand the list. Here's a quick look at some of the leading contenders in the blossoming Commercial iMovie Plug-ins category:

  • GeeThree . At www.geethree.com, you can preview and buy plug-in collections that add over 200 new transitions to iMovie's list. They offer a huge number of different shapes that open up to reveal a new piece of footage: hearts, barn doors, checkerboards, zigzags, page turns, swirls, explosions, drips from the top of the screen, and so on. You can also find picture-in-picture, morphing, and even image-stabilizing plug-ins that take the shake out of unsteady footage.


    Note: Be sure to confirm that any iMovie plug-ins you install are compatible with version 6. Most previous plug-ins, unfortunately , won't work right.
  • Virtix . Check out www.virtix.com to view this impressive set of effects and transitions. Burn Through makes it look like the first piece of film is melting on the projector, revealing the second clip behind it. Dream should be familiar to David Letterman or "Wayne's World" fans: It creates a soft-focused, warpy, zig-zaggy strip down the center of the frame that melts into the second clip. Fog and Smoke reveal the second clip through a passing haze. If you've shot one clip of an empty space (using a tripod) and another containing a person, Materialize creates a convincing simulation of the Star Trek transporter beam. And so on.

  • cf/x . The transition effects at www.imovieplugins.com are very nicely done; some, like a soft-edged wipe, are even more useful than some of Apple's included transitions. What's especially nice is that you can buy these transitions individually (usually $3.50 or $4.50) instead of having to buy a whole package.


Tip: Most of these products come with installers that put the plug-in files where they belong: in your Home Library iMovie Plug-ins folder. Knowing where they live also makes it easy to remove themwhich may come in handy in times of troubleshooting.
